| CVE | Vendors | Products | Updated | CVSS v3.1 |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| CVE-2026-2234 | 1 Hgiga | 1 C&cm@il Package Olln-base | 2026-02-10 | 9.1 Critical |
| C&Cm@il developed by HGiga has a Missing Authentication vulnerability, allowing unauthenticated remote attackers to read and modify any user's mail content. | ||||
| CVE-2026-2235 | 1 Hgiga | 1 C&cm@il Package Olln-base | 2026-02-10 | 6.5 Medium |
| C&Cm@il developed by HGiga has a SQL Injection vulnerability, allowing authenticated remote attackers to inject arbitrary SQL commands to read database contents. | ||||
| CVE-2026-2236 | 1 Hgiga | 1 C&cm@il Package Olln-base | 2026-02-10 | 7.5 High |
| C&Cm@il developed by HGiga has a SQL Injection vulnerability, allowing unauthenticated remote attackers to inject arbitrary SQL commands to read database contents. | ||||
| CVE-2024-4296 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Isherlock | 2026-01-26 | 4.9 Medium |
| The account management interface of HGiga iSherlock (including MailSherlock, SpamSherlock, AuditSherlock) fails to filter special characters in certain function parameters, allowing remote attackers with administrative privileges to exploit this vulnerability to download arbitrary system files. | ||||
| CVE-2024-4297 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Isherlock | 2026-01-26 | 4.9 Medium |
| The system configuration interface of HGiga iSherlock (including MailSherlock, SpamSherlock, AuditSherlock) fails to filter special characters in certain function parameters, allowing remote attackers with administrative privileges to exploit this vulnerability to download arbitrary system files. | ||||
| CVE-2024-4298 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Isherlock | 2026-01-26 | 7.2 High |
| The email search interface of HGiga iSherlock (including MailSherlock, SpamSherock, AuditSherlock) fails to filter special characters in certain function parameters, allowing remote attackers with administrative privileges to exploit this vulnerability for Command Injection attacks, enabling execution of arbitrary system commands. | ||||
| CVE-2024-4299 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Isherlock | 2026-01-26 | 7.2 High |
| The system configuration interface of HGiga iSherlock (including MailSherlock, SpamSherock, AuditSherlock) fails to filter special characters in certain function parameters, allowing remote attackers with administrative privileges to exploit this vulnerability for Command Injection attacks, enabling execution of arbitrary system commands. | ||||
| CVE-2025-11900 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Isherlock | 2025-10-21 | 9.8 Critical |
| The iSherlock developed by HGiga has an OS Command Injection vulnerability, allowing unauthenticated remote attackers to inject arbitrary OS commands and execute them on the server. | ||||
| CVE-2025-7451 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Isherlock | 2025-07-15 | 9.8 Critical |
| The iSherlock developed by Hgiga has an OS Command Injection vulnerability, allowing unauthenticated remote attackers to inject arbitrary OS commands and execute them on the server. This vulnerability has already been exploited. Please update immediately. | ||||
| CVE-2025-3361 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Isherlock | 2025-06-24 | 9.8 Critical |
| The web service of iSherlock from HGiga has an OS Command Injection vulnerability, allowing unauthenticated remote attackers to inject arbitrary OS commands and execute them on the server. | ||||
| CVE-2025-3362 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Isherlock | 2025-06-24 | 9.8 Critical |
| The web service of iSherlock from HGiga has an OS Command Injection vulnerability, allowing unauthenticated remote attackers to inject arbitrary OS commands and execute them on the server. | ||||
| CVE-2025-3363 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Isherlock | 2025-06-24 | 9.8 Critical |
| The web service of iSherlock from HGiga has an OS Command Injection vulnerability, allowing unauthenticated remote attackers to inject arbitrary OS commands and execute them on the server. | ||||
| CVE-2025-3364 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Powerstation | 2025-06-24 | 6.7 Medium |
| The SSH service of PowerStation from HGiga has a Chroot Escape vulnerability, allowing attackers with root privileges to bypass chroot restrictions and access the entire file system. | ||||
| CVE-2025-2150 | 1 Hgiga | 1 C\&cm\@il | 2025-03-24 | 5.4 Medium |
| The C&Cm@il from HGiga has a St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ability, allowing remote attackers with regular privileges to send emails containing malicious JavaScript code, which will be executed in the recipient's browser when they view the email. | ||||
| CVE-2023-24837 | 1 Hgiga | 2 Powerstation, Powerstation Firmware | 2025-02-19 | 8.8 High |
| HGiga PowerStation remote management function has insufficient filtering for user input. An authenticated remote attacker with general user privilege can exploit this vulnerability to inject and execute arbitrary system commands to perform arbitrary system operation or disrupt service. | ||||
| CVE-2023-24838 | 1 Hgiga | 2 Powerstation, Powerstation Firmware | 2025-02-19 | 9.8 Critical |
| HGiga PowerStation has a vulnerability of Information Leakage. An unauthenticated remote attacker can exploit this vulnerability to obtain the administrator's credential. This credential can then be used to login PowerStation or Secure Shell to achieve remote code execution. | ||||
| CVE-2023-24839 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Oaklouds Mailsherlock | 2025-02-19 | 6.1 Medium |
| HGiga MailSherlock’s specific function has insufficient filtering for user input. An unauthenticated remote attacker can exploit this vulnerability to inject JavaScript, conducting a reflected XSS attack. | ||||
| CVE-2023-24840 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Oaklouds Mailsherlock | 2025-02-19 | 7.2 High |
| HGiga MailSherlock mail query function has vulnerability of insufficient validation for user input. An authenticated remote attacker with administrator privilege can exploit this vulnerability to inject SQL commands to read, modify, and delete the database. | ||||
| CVE-2023-24841 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Oaklouds Mailsherlock | 2025-02-19 | 7.2 High |
| HGiga MailSherlock query function for connection log has a vulnerability of insufficient filtering for user input. An authenticated remote attacker with administrator privilege can exploit this vulnerability to inject and execute arbitrary system commands to perform arbitrary system operation or disrupt service. | ||||
| CVE-2023-24842 | 1 Hgiga | 1 Oaklouds Mailsherlock | 2025-02-19 | 5.3 Medium |
| HGiga MailSherlock has vulnerability of insufficient access control. An unauthenticated remote user can exploit this vulnerability to access partial content of another user’s mail by changing user ID and mail ID within URL. | ||||
